The "Odori Park Building" on the north side of Odori 6-chome, with a strong business district atmosphere, appears to be a normal office building at first glance. However, upon climbing the stairs and entering the building, there is a food court located at the back. There are two Chinese restaurants and one cafe as tenants. The spacious floor can accommodate around 100 people, but the ceiling is low, giving a slightly cramped feeling. I visited after 3 PM, with only 3 groups of 4 customers already finished with lunch, so I decided to have coffee at "Takagi Coffee". The prices are reasonable with sizes available in Small for 200 yen, Medium for 300 yen, and Large for 340 yen. I was surprised to find out that having a meal at the other Chinese restaurants would further reduce the price by half. I purchased a Medium size coffee, poured into a takeout cup, paid with PayPay, and then received it. The coffee had a mild bitterness and acidity, making it easy to drink. The Medium size seemed to contain over 350ml, and the Large size may have been around 500ml. It might be crowded during lunchtime, but it seems convenient and easy to use outside of peak hours. However, I wonder why there are two Chinese restaurants in the building. I would like to visit again, but with Sunday being their regular holiday, I am unsure about the timing. I arrived at Takagi Coffee on the second floor of the building where Yakult is located in Otemachi West 6-chome. This area serves as a food court for Daiko, Nishi Roku Kitchen, and Takagi Coffee. I visited in the evening and the atmosphere was not like a party, so I could relax. Moody music was playing a bit loudly. The blended coffee size M for 300 yen was really voluminous. If the M size is this big, I wonder how big the L size would be? Next door is Nishi Roku Kitchen, and I wonder if they share staff because the lady who served me was very kind and cheerful. The coffee had a good balance of acidity, bitterness, and richness. It was brewed in advance, so it tasted delicious. There are no facilities like charging stations or Wi-Fi, but it's a nice place to relax. Thank you for the meal. ☺️
